Tresys Technology Announces the Release of the
SELinux Integrated Development Tool (SLIDE) Preview 3
Columbia, Maryland– October 25, 2006 – Tresys Technology has released their third preview version of SLIDE, an integrated development environment (IDE) for Security Enhanced Linux (SELinux) developers and integrators. SLIDE provides features to make the task of SELinux policy development and debugging easier, by providing wizards to automate common tasks, and by providing developer-friendly features. SLIDE is designed for use with the Reference Policy, another open source project by Tresys that has become the standard SELinux security policy.
This release of SLIDE provides new features to make the task of writing, testing, and debugging SELinux policies easier. SLIDE now provides the option to install the policy under development onto a remote machine for testing and integrates remote audit monitoring, thereby facilitating policy debugging.
